Conditional Offers to the UK’s top universities

Once again, Bellerbys College students from all four centres have received offers to attend the best universities in the UK. At this time of year, UK universities interview students for places at their respective institutions. The selection process is highly competitive, with many students attempting to win places to their first-choice universities. Bellerbys College students are able to compete at the very highest level, receiving offers from the top universities.

Ban-Ruo Andy Li - China

A Levels: Maths, Further Maths, Physics, Chemistry & Economics

Conditional Offer: Trinity College, University of Cambridge  ( AAA in Maths, Further Maths & Physics) t o study Computer Science

“ Bellerbys College provides a one hour Tutor Group session every week to all students. My tutor, Dr. Cameron has been particularly helpful; he guided me and my fellows through our UCAS applications and provided all of us lots of useful information and helpful advices. The specialty about Bellerbys is the once-every-week Oxbridge meeting hosted by the programme manager Mr. Corcut. All Oxbridge prospective students in Bellerbys gather together, talk about recent affairs and express our own perspectives. This is an excellent and unique platform to prepare for the "tricky" Oxbridge interviews in December. Unlike public schools in the UK, Bellerbys does provide a lot of support in studies to students at the beginning of their courses and this is found most useful by new foreign students who are not familiar with the language, with the British education systems and with the culture. Teachers in Bellerbys are not only committed to helping students acquire enough As to go to a good University, they are, more importantly, committed to teaching students the learning methods they need at university. In this sense, Bellerbys really provides a thoughtful and caring Preparation for University Education.

Robert Kopaczyk - Polish/German

A levels: German, Maths, Physics, Psychology

Conditional Offer: Imperial College London (AAA) to study Computer Science

“I accepted Imperial as my firm offer. They offered me AAA, but this includes German A level which I already have. I visited Imperial and really liked it. In the interview, the tutor asked me one question and said that his question was very hard and he’d give me a few hints if I didn’t know it. So I thought for a while and then said to him, ‘I can’t solve this problem,’ and he said, ‘I can’t solve this either.’ It made me laugh and I very much liked that attitude. Some of the other colleges I visited didn’t appeal to me as much, but that is what visits are for. At Bellerbys we’re not just studying our subjects, we often debate other issues in class, across subjects from immigration to evolutionary psychology.”
